When adopting solar panel, there are monocrystalline silicon and polycrystalline silicon for choice. What's the differernce between them and how to choose?

1. Difference in production procedure. 

Monocrystalline silicon is made from high-purity silicon. Polycrystalline silicon is made from silicon that is made during making single crystalline. Simply speaking, Monocrystalline silicon is single panel, and polycrystalline silicon is plywood panel.

2. Difference in permutation. 

To be specific, Monocrystalline permutation is regular and polycrystalline permutation is irregular.

3. Difference in appearance. 

Monocrystalline has smooth surface with beautiful color. It is dark blue and looks like black.

Polycrystalline has slight different color because its permutation is irregular. It looks blue.

4. Difference in Photovoltaic conversion efficiency. 

Monocrystalline has higher density and lower power loss. It has better photovoltaic conversion efficiency that reaches about 20%. Over 20% is high efficient.

Polycrystalline has lower density and higher power loss. So, its photovoltaic conversion efficiency is about 15%.

5. Difference in cost. 

Monocrystalline has higher cost than polycrystalline.
